What is the proper way to spool Amsteel Blue on a winch?
I spooled by holding onto the rope and leaning back to put pressure on the rope and spooled it in. I then pulled up several small stumps up to four or five inches in diameter with no problem. Then a week later I tried to pull up another stump about the same size and the rope spun on the spool and pulled the rope out of the crimped terminal end
. There was some tight pulls because some of the rope was smashed.
Also the end of the rope was wrapped in electrical tape before crimping. When it pulled out it unwrapped the first layer of electrical tape but the rest was still in place.
Was this caused by the crimping not being tight enough, not spooling with enough resistance or something else?
If it was because I didn’t spool with enough resistance then what is the proper technique? It seems to me that if I spooled with more resistance after the first few wraps I would still risk pulling the rope out of the terminal end. I apologize if I’m missing something simple.
The terminal end looks like a battery cable end. Is this what I should use to replace the old one? I was thinking of maybe singeing the rope end and running the retainer bolt through the rope but I’m not sure that would be a good idea.
